Tl;Dr for someone who was not around for the entertainment last year?
Two QB league. Huge accelerator points for dumb shit like 40/50/60+ yard TD throw. Similar accelerator points for long TD catches but not the same accelerators for long runs by RBs/QBs. RBs are mostly interchangeable because of how few points they produce. QBs then are extremely valuable but again it's hard to get any kind of educated guess as to who will be the best to use with the accelerators. Example from last year: Lamar Jackson was pretty much the consensus QB1 for fantasy in pretty much all scoring. In this dumb league he was the sixth best QB. Getting beaten out by: Dak, Jameis, Matt Ryan, Mahomes and Philip Rivers. Decent QBs average 75 points a game but in just the one year I played you can get ones that put up 150 points alone. RB, by contrast, average about 15 points a game for a solid performance. Even McCaffrey with his crazy receiving numbers only averaged 30 points.

Then on top of that there are random little things like in the playoffs the higher seeded team is automatically spotted 10 points. Which is just head scratching because the weekly points total per team averages 250-300 points so why bother? There were other things I'm not remembering but mostly it was about the accelerator points and such making it more of just a coin flip as to who won each week rather than using any kind of knowledge etc to put together the best team.
